几种削减变压器励磁涌流的方法 被引量:31

Several Methods to Reduce Transformer Inrush Current

摘要 变压器在空载合闸时将产生很大的励磁涌流,这种励磁涌流对变压器的稳定运行极为不利。为削减这种励磁涌流,提出了3种方法:控制三相开关合闸的时间法,内插电阻法和改变变压器绕组的分布法。理论分析和实验表明,这3种方法各有其优缺点,都能有效地削减励磁涌流,前两种方法的可行性更好。 Large inrush current occurs when energizing unloaded transformer in power system, which provides unfavorable condition in transformer operation. Three methods are proposed in this paper to reduce inrush current: by controlled three-phase switching; by resistor insertion and by changing the distribution of coil winding. The three methods are proved to be effective both by the theoretical and practical considerations which all have advantages and disadvantages, but the feasibility of the former two methods is better.
